Official Site Position Declaration:

Hey, I'm very excited for Mother 3 and hopefully plan to get it around the release date. My only concern is that I won't be able to read it, thus not knowing what will be going on in the game (kind of like Mother 1 for me when I imported Mother 1+2).

Will Starmen.net have a guide of any kind leading fans to the end of the game while knowing the story is about? I know there was something on here one time that lead people to a certain point in EB everyday until they finished the game. Thanks!

- NintendoLord

You are correct, sir! Every summer we run the EB Funktastic GamePlay event, where everybody plays EB at roughly the same pace over the course of a month. The thing is, we started that back in 2001 because a lot of people hadn't played EB in a long time, and we had to get back in the game! (Woo, site slogans!)

On the other hand, we're not sure if Mother 3's going to come out in English, and we wouldn't want to ruin it for anyone who was waiting for it if it did by posting information about the Japanese version in advance. So our official position is this: after April 20th, the info will be available to those who want it, such as importers like yourself. But we won't go mega-crazy with telling everyone all about what it's like until we're reasonably certain it wouldn't be coming out over here anyway. Basically, if there's no announcement by the fall, then we'll commence with in-depth translations and guides and stuff like that. But we're really hoping we won't have to do that.

--- SimonBob

Petitions:

Hey SimonBob! I am really wanting to know if Starmen.net is going to be making a petition to get Mother 3 "Americanized"? I signed the petition a long time ago to get Earthbound 64 over here but we all know how that turned out... Anyhow, looking forward to more mailbag updates!

- Oscar Taylor

Nope. Nope, nope, nope. See, we did a Mother 3 petition back in 2002/03 that got over 30,000 signatures - that was definitely enough to get Nintendo's attention. Now that we know Mother 3 is coming out, even if it's only in Japanese, we're gonna kick back and let the big N call the shots for a bit. If 2007 rolls around and we still don't have an EarthBound 2, then we'll start thinking about rolling out more petitions or sieges or something. (I'm talkin' to you, M3 board spammers! Enough with the "start a petition" topics! We're not doing it!)

--- SimonBob
